Overview
The HMC187AMS8ETR is a miniature frequency doubler Monolithic Microwave Integrated Circuit (MMIC) produced by Analog Devices Inc. This component is housed in an 8-lead MSOP (Micro Small Outline Package) and is designed to operate as a passive frequency doubler. It is particularly useful for applications requiring the suppression of undesired fundamental and higher order harmonics. The HMC187AMS8ETR is suitable for various RF and microwave applications due to its compact size and high performance characteristics.
Key Specifications
Parameter | Value |
---|---|
Input Frequency Range | 0.85 - 2.0 GHz |
Output Frequency Range | 1.7 - 4.0 GHz |
Conversion Loss | Typically 15 dB |
Isolation (Fo, 3Fo, 4Fo) | 40 dB |
Input Drive Level | 10 to 20 dBm |
Package Type | 8-lead MSOP |
Operating Temperature | -40°C to +85°C |
